I have a Dell Axim X30 with wireless LAN and Bluetooth.

It hadn't been used for a while, so was flat as a pancake. No memory stored, no external software on it etc etc.

I've configured it to use a couple of 802.11 access points and it works fine - IMAP e-mail MSN etc etc.

My trouble starts when I disable the wireless connections with the button on the side. The dialog comes up telling me that the wireless is disabled and the lights go off.

All well and good.

From then on, I get a notification every 20 secs or so saying "Unable to connect: You have no modem entries created, and no network card present"

I know. The network is disabled. I'm not trying to access a network. STOP TELLING ME EVERY 20 SECS.:mad:

How can I tell it to fail silently? I don't even know what's trying to access the network: I've done a soft reset, left it at the "today" screen, and still it does it.
